In hot summer have I great rejoicing The sestina is a complex, thirty-nine-line poem featuring theintricate repetition of end-words in six stanzas and an envoi. 1 A sea god in Greek mythology with the ability to prophesize the future. Yes, were alike, How we pronounce, say, lichen, and dislike. sestina: [noun] a lyrical fixed form consisting of six 6-line usually unrhymed stanzas in which the end words of the first stanza recur as end words of the following five stanzas in a successively rotating order and as the middle and end words of the three verses of the concluding tercet. The sestina follows a strict pattern of the repetition of the initial six end-words of the first stanza through the remaining five six-line stanzas, culminating in a three-line envoi. While Schimel mourns the loss of a generation, Patricia Smith narrows her gaze to the loss of a particular life in Ethels Sestina from Blood Dazzler, her 2008 book-length portrait of Hurricane Katrina and its aftermath. X is a tale of loves gone wrong whose end words double down by all sharing the twenty-fourth letter of the alphabet: excuses, extra, ex, crux, deluxe, and fix (plus plausible substitutions, such as ax for ex), culminating in what seems to be death itself, journey[ing] on the Styx with Mr. X in our boat..
